关于Linux内核的理解:内核是什么以及如何选用

时间:2025-12-06 分类:操作系统

Linux内核是现代操作系统的核心组成部分,它负责管理系统硬件和软件资源,并提供基础服务给上层应用程序。作为开源软件,Linux内核的设计灵活且功能强大,能够广泛应用于从个人电脑到大型服务器的各种场景。因其高度的可定制性,用户和开发者可以根据自身需求选择合适的内核版本。这使得Linux在技术上不断演进,且能满足不同场合的特定需求。对想深入了解计算机系统的人来说,理解内核的工作机制是极其重要的。

关于Linux内核的理解:内核是什么以及如何选用

Linux内核的主要功能是作为系统的资源管理器,它管理 CPU、内存、存储设备和网络接口等基础硬件。在多用户、多任务的操作环境中,内核通过调度算法有效分配这些资源,确保每个进程都能及时获得所需的资源,从而实现系统的高效运行。内核也提供了底层的硬件抽象,使得用户程序可以在不需要详细了解硬件的情况下运行。

选择合适的Linux内核版本至关重要。不同版本的内核可能适合不同的应用场景。例如,企业级环境可能需要选择稳定性和安全性极为重要的版本,而开发者则更倾向于使用包含最新功能与改进的版本。用户在选用内核时,需结合自身的需求进行综合评估。

Linux内核的社区支持也不容忽视。一个活跃的社区不仅能为用户提供丰富的文档、教程和论坛讨论,还能帮助用户快速解决使用中的问题。在选择内核版本时,要考虑社区活跃程度及其对该版本的支持情况。

深入理解Linux内核以及合理选择合适的版本对于系统的性能和安全性有着至关重要的影响。无论是个人开发还是企业应用,了解内核的基本原理与选择策略都能帮助用户更好地利用这一强大工具。随着技术的不断发展,掌握Linux内核的最新动态与趋势也是保持竞争力的必要手段。